Whose Dunk Earned the Perfect Score: Anthony Edwards or Jalen Johnson?

Two of the best dunks in the NBA took place last night in a span of two hours.

Timberwolves’ Anthony Edwards and the Hawks’ Jalen Johnson gave fans the show they came for, respectively.

The Timberwolves star shooting guard had arguably his best dunk in his brief NBA Career. Elevating a step past the free throw line, Edwards dunked on John Collins so hard that he couldn’t celebrate due to him dislocating his finger. Sourced also reported following the game that Collins suffered a head contusion on the play.

The Atlanta Hawks played back-to-back in Los Angeles over the past few days, However, it’s their Lakers match-up that had a viral moment. Jalen Johnson set the tempo for the game in the first few minutes by soaring over Austin Reeves, who was positioned in the restricted area, to execute a massive one-hand slam.

Austin was asked after the game about the dunk, and he showed that he was a good sport about it.

“Everybody saw what happened,” the Lakers shooting guard said in response to the question. “But we didn’t have your view though,” the journalist responded. “You don’t want my view,” Reaves said.
